Challenge
The stakes were high with this event as its success directly impacts Boiler Room's future in the city. Significant financial pressures, due to the absence of major sponsors, placed a heavy reliance on ticket sales. Adding to these challenges, X3D Studio, a blank canvas with no prior event history, presented unique logistical hurdles. Additionally, curating a compelling lineup posed a critical challenge: balancing established and emerging local talent to captivate a global audience. This required representing the authentic soul of Singapore’s underground music scene, demanding careful consideration and bold choices.
Solution
To mitigate financial risks, a phased ticketing approach was implemented, spearheaded by the Boiler Room HQ, which worked remarkably to heighten excitement and drive early sales. We also focused on securing partnerships with brands that aligned with the event’s ethos, ensuring support was met while complementing the spirit of the Boiler Room. On the venue end, we place the focus on technical expertise and meticulous planning to create a Boiler Room haven from a raw industrial space. Finally, we curated a bold, all-female lineup, a first for Boiler Room, that brings out the best of international and local talent and amplifying the event’s cultural impact.
